What Is a Custom Home Builder in Texas?
A custom home builder in Texas is a professional who designs and constructs a one-of-a-kind home based entirely on your preferences, land, and budget.
Unlike production or tract builders, custom builders:
Design homes from scratch or modify architect plans
Build on your own land
Allow full control over layout, materials, and finishes
Adapt designs to Texas climate and zoning requirements

How Much Do Custom Home Builders in Texas Cost?
Most custom homes in Texas cost between $150 and $350+ per square foot in 2026.
Factors That Affect Cost:
Location (urban vs rural Texas)
Size and complexity of the home
Material and finish selections
Energy-efficient or smart upgrades
Site preparation and land conditions

Custom Home Builders vs Production Texas Home Builders
Feature | Custom Home Builders Texas | Production Texas Home Builders |
Design | Fully customized | Limited floor plans |
Build Location | Your land | Builder-owned lots |
Flexibility | High | Low |
Cost | Higher upfront | Lower upfront |
Personalization | Full control | Minimal |

How Long Does It Take to Build a Custom Home in Texas?
Most custom homes take 8 to 14 months to complete.
Typical Timeline:
Design & planning: 1–3 months
Permits & approvals: 1–2 months
Construction: 6–9 months
Delays can occur due to weather, material availability, or design changes, which experienced custom home builders Texas know how to manage efficiently.
